At present, the college is unique in that it has under one umbrella six academic units: the School of Architecture, the M.E. Rinker, Sr. School of Building Construction, the Departments of Interior Design, Landscape Architecture, and Urban and Regional Planning, and the DCP Doctoral Program. With a student body of approximately 1,500 and around 100 faculty members, DCP is one of the largest programs nationally, and its funded research ranks in the top five.
The college continues to expand its international programs with new programs such as the design programs in Hong Kong and Paris to complement its current international programs in Italy, Mexico, and Latin America.
In addition, the college has added an Interdisciplinary Concentration and Certificate in Historic Preservation (ICCHP). It was created to integrate existing historic preservation resources across the college and university.
